Brasília Is The Selected Capital For The Launch Of The 5G Network In Brazil
With about 3 years of delay compared to the rest of the world, the implementation of the 5G network in Brazil is finally going to happen and the first capital to receive the 5G signal for mobile telephony will be Brasília
According to Moisés Moreira, the counselor and vice president of the National Telecommunications Agency (Anatel), the signal will be released this Wednesday (07/06).
How Will The 5G Network Be Implemented?
Speaking at the Teletime Inc event in São Paulo, the technical group of Anatel that is responsible for evaluating the clearing of the 3.5 gigahertz (GHz) band approved yesterday (07/04) the activation of the 5G signal in Brasília.

It is true that, initially, the forecast was that all capitals would have the 5G signal released by July 31, 2022, however, at the beginning of the year, the operators were already saying they were facing some obstacles.
To create the infrastructure for transmitting the 5G signal, the municipalities should approve a municipal law allowing the installation of the equipment. Of the 26 capitals, only 10 and the Federal District already have laws that allow this installation, which needs to be done on the rooftops of buildings or on light poles.
This was probably one of the reasons why the federal capital was the first to have the 5G network operational for mobile telephony. And, according to Moreira, São Paulo, Belo Horizonte, and Porto Alegre will be the next capitals to have the 5G signal released, but still without a deadline for when.
But, there is a new deadline! The operation of the 5G technology in all capitals has been postponed to September 29. The launch of the 5G network in Brasília will serve as a test, with Anatel and mobile operators installing anti-interference filters.
Check The History Of The 5G Licensing Process
As we mentioned before, the bidding notice for the 5G auction, which took place in November 2021, projected that all capitals would have the 5G technology implemented by 07/31/2022.
However, due to setbacks related to the COVID-19 pandemic, such as chip shortages and delays in the production and import of electronic equipment, this timeline has changed.
Additionally, there are other necessary adaptations, such as the signal migration process from satellite antennas. According to ANATEL, the capitals of Brazil would be the first to change the frequencies of open television starting June 30. The list of open satellite TV channels should migrate from Band C to Band Ku. This will also lead to an improvement in audio and video quality, according to the Frequency Administrating Entity (EAF), responsible for the migration.
Moreira is also the president of the Anatel technical group responsible for releasing the frequency (3.5GHz) through which the 5G telephone signal will transit, and currently, this frequency migration is also delayed.

Well, to start, about 50,000 jobs are expected to be created in 2022 with the arrival of 5G, according to Conexis Brasil Digital and Brasscom, entities that work in telecommunications and connectivity.
The 5G technology has the potential to revolutionize many areas, and it is a misconception to think it is only in telecommunications. Agronomy, medicine, information technology, industrial sector, education, entertainment, in short, there are no restrictions. And finally, we remind you that the 5G technology was acquired by only 3 operators: TIM, Claro, and Vivo. The operators claim that customers who already have 4G plans will be able to upgrade at no cost, they just need to have a phone adapted for the 5G technology.
